Qualification Requirements

Before you start filling out your application, it’s essential to meet the qualification requirements for the IBPS PO and Clerk exams. Here’s what you need:

Probationary Officer (PO)

  • Graduation in any discipline from a recognized university.
  • Age between 20 and 30 years (as of 31st December 2023).

Clerk

  • A 12th pass certificate from a recognized board.
  • Age between 18 and 28 years (as of 31st December 2023).

Age Limit Criteria

Age is a crucial factor in your eligibility for these positions. Here’s the age limit criteria for both roles:

Probationary Officer (PO)

  • General: 20-30 years
  • OBC: 20-33 years
  • SC/ST: 20-35 years
  • PWD: 20-38 years

Clerk

  • General: 18-28 years
  • OBC: 18-31 years
  • SC/ST: 18-33 years
  • PWD: 18-35 years

Selection Process

The selection process for the IBPS PO and Clerk exams comprises two major phases.

Phase 1: Online Preliminary Exam

The preliminary exam is the first hurdle you’ll need to clear. It’s an objective test featuring three sections:

  • Quantitative Aptitude
  • Reasoning Ability
  • English Language

Phase 2: Online Mains Exam

If you succeed in the preliminary exam, you’ll proceed to the mains exam, which is also an objective test. It encompasses four sections:

  • Quantitative Aptitude
  • Reasoning Ability
  • English Language
  • General Awareness

Interview

Candidates who successfully navigate the online mains exam will be invited for an interview. This interview is a pivotal step and is conducted by a panel of experts. It assesses your communication skills, personality, and overall suitability for the job.
